Went to writers' group. Hooray! Most of the fun people were there. [livejournal.com profile] witchofrock showed up!

I was massively unprepared, but managed to fake it with some Necromancer's Prayer.

I have started reading The Artist's Way, and while I do have some eyebrow-raising on some minor points (matters of technique and the handling of some situations), I think that most of it is good sound stuff and I'm planning to get a copy of it for Certain People for Certain Holidays.

My first Artist's Date wound up being the con last Saturday. I've been doing a sort of approximation of morning pages at work, though quite a bit has historically been coming out on LJ. It does clear out the brain something wonderfully, but the problem is that I often have too much on the brain to clear out in three pages. That, and there's content mixed in, plus I get interrupted. But it's been doing things.
